    I have installed the free version of wptouch. My site displays great. My problem is that when I tap the “read this post” link below each abbreviated post, wptouch simply reloads/refreshes the page rather than displaying the full post.

    I did edit the css file, and add a function to “core-functions.php” that lets a user tap to call from the menu. I also added an image to “header.php” between the menu and search bar.

    I have tried:

    1. disabling all plugins
    2. reinstalling wp-touch without the edited files with all plugins disabled.
    3. restoring wp-touch default settings

    I am considering purchasing the unlimited wp-touch pro license so that I can use this plugin on sites for my clients, but I need to figure out why the full posts wont display before I do.

    Anyone have any ideas?

  • We do not support customizations of the free version of WPtouch beyond the options given in the admin interface. Tap-to-call functionality is usually added as a simple link in this format so there shouldn’t be a need to alter core code. :

    <a href="tel:555-555-5555">Call Now!</a>

    If you’ve installed a fresh copy of WPtouch and tested with all other plugins disabled, the next step is to temporarily switch to a compatible theme such as TwentyTwelve in order to verify that your WPtouch installation is sound. If it is, then there is likely a conflict with one or more functions in your desktop theme.

    WPtouch Pro is fully customizable and can be setup to work around such conflicts. I see you’ve altered the number of posts displaying on the home page so start there to see where the default functionality may have been broken.
